List 5 reasons why you are a geek. And make them good reasons. Justify them. Explain them. Be loud & proud about how big of a geek you are!

1. My first computing experience was in my junior year in high school when my electronics teacher recommended me for a no credit course in computer programming at Gonzaga University. I learned FORTRAN on an IBM 360. And punched my own card.

2. I started gaming in 1974 with the "wood grain box" edition of D&D. And have *extensive* notes on the worlds I started designing back then. Haven't had time to do much with them in a while, but I've got a paper box full of just *my* gaming stuff. That's stuff I've written drawn. Not actual purchased stuff. That's *several* other boxes.

3. [livejournal.com profile] gridlore mentioned odd gaming systems. I own a copy of the TSR release (first ed) of Empire of the Petal Throne. I have all 7 issues of the TSR magazine that *preceeded* The Dragon. I have all three editions of Gamma World and the First three of Boot Hioll, as well as Metamorphis Alpha. I havbe the original 3 volumes of the Arduin Grimoire. And on and on...

4. I have computers that date back to 1978 (I got that one second hand). I still own my first computer. I owbn computers that use 8" floppies. As well as ones that use 5.25" floppies. And a number that use cassette tape (Including actual honest to God IBM PCs)

5. I have *three* domains and responsibility for a 4th, I have file servers accessible over the net (no, I'm not telling you how). I have a weather station posting iinfo to a page on one of my web sites.

And a 6th that only real geeks/nerds will get:
I've been on the Internet since before the "Great Renaming on Usenet, And before the domain naming system. My first *three* email addresses were bang path style addresses.
